Group next/prev or up/down keys in help dialog

Instead of putting two navigation keys on their own lines in the help
dialog, cluster them by sibling relationship (up/down, next/prev) and
show the pair on one line:

  n / p : Next page / previous page
  ] / [ : Next file / previous file

To improve clustering of identical actions and make it easier to
locate a task each group is now sorted by help text, rather than
by key stroke.
